Why Your SIBO Keeps Coming Back: The Overlooked Root Causes of Recurring SIBO & Bloating | Ep 372
In this engaging discussion, Rachel Heintz, a Registered Dietitian Nutritionist specializing in gut health, teams up with Erin to delve into the persistent problem of recurring SIBO. They unpack why common treatments often miss key root causes like low stomach acid and bile flow. Rachel highlights how grazing habits can hinder gut healing, and they explore the surprising effects of serotonin and mineral imbalances on digestion. This insightful conversation is packed with actionable tips for anyone struggling with bloating and gut dysfunction.

Endometriosis 101: Why Gut Health, Histamines, and Toxins Matter | Ep 366
If you've ever been told that endometriosis is “just a hormonal issue”, this episode will challenge everything you thought you knew. Endo is not a simple diagnosis - it’s a whole body inflammatory disease, and conventional approaches often miss key contributors like gut dysbiosis, immune dysfunction, and histamine intolerance. Through powerful client case studies, Erin highlights how a root cause lens can bring real relief where protocols alone fall short.You’ll learn how functional testing like stool analysis, SIBO breath tests, and even mold and toxin panels can uncover what's really going on beneath your symptoms.
